Weapons car — 3 held
Date published: 17 November 2008
THREE men, whose car was loaded with weapons, have been arrested after officers suspected they were targeting a cash in transit delivery.
They were held after officers stopped a Skoda Octavia in Oldham at 1.30am on Friday.
At around 11.30pm on Thursday, officers accompanied a delivery to a Rochdale bank. Patrols approached the car and asked the men what they were doing.
They later approached the vehicle again, but the occupants drove away, only to be spotted later in Failsworth. A search of the car revealed an axe, a lump hammer, a crowbar, gloves and a mask.
The arrests form part of Operation Vanguard, an initiative to try to disrupt robbers who target cash in transit robberies.
